For each number given below, write expressions in at least two different ways to obtain the number through button clicks. Think like Chitti and be creative. Class 7
(a) 8300
(b) 40629
(c) 56354
(d) 66666
(e) 367813
Solution:
(a) (80 × 100) + (30 × 10) = 8300
(8 × 1000) + (3 × 100) = 8300
(b) (40 × 1000) + (62 × 10) + 9 × 1 = 40629
(4 × 10000) + (6 × 100) + (29 × 1) = 40629
(c) (56 × 1000) + (3 × 100) + (54 × 1) = 56354
(5 × 10000) + (6 × 1000) + (35 × 10) + (4 × 1) = 56354
(d) (66 × 1000) + (6 × 100) + (66 × 1) = 66666
(6 × 10000) + (6 × 1000) + (6 × 100) + (6 × 10) + 6 × 1 = 66666
(e) (367 × 1000) + (81 × 10) + 3 × 1 = 367813
(36 × 10000) + (78 × 100) + (13 × 1) = 367813
